CareerLink
CareerLink is a great online networking service. Alumni can use
CareerLink to serve as a mentor to current students and to have their
resume or profile available for employers to search for potential
employees. Employers can post current job openings, search alumni and
student profiles and resumes, and create on-campus interview
schedules. The Career Center encourages alumni interested in
short-term or ongoing student mentoring to use CareerLink in this
manner. Setting up your CareerLink account is FREE!
Alumni Career Profiles
For those who have completed an alumni career profile, they have been moved to CareerLink where they will still be used by freshmen and sophomores who haven't decided on a major. If you want to update or change your profile, you have a CareerLink account, which is your firstname.lastname (all lowercase), and the password is "password" (For example: sam.houston). Once you access your account, you are encouraged to change your password.
If you haven't completed a career profile, we invite you to share your experiences about various industries and jobs, along with what it takes to be a Christian practitioner. The profiles will be used by students in the Discovery program and in University Seminar (U100), which is required of all incoming students. Outside sources will not have access to your information.
